Chelsey Dunivan named to Dean's Honor List at Morningside College

2011 Jan 6

Chelsey Dunivan, daughter of Chuck and Nancy Dunivan of Meadow Grove, Neb., was named to the Dean's Honor List at Morningside College for the 2010 fall semester.

Dunivan, a junior who is majoring in computer science and business administration, is a past graduate of Elkhorn Valley High School.

Each semester the Dean's Honor List recognizes students who achieve a 3.67 grade point average or better and complete at least 12 credits of course work with no grade below a "C-." William C. Deeds recently released the fall 2010 Dean's Honor List, and each student received a letter of recognition from Deeds.

Morningside College enrolled 1,991 full-time and part-time students for the 2010 fall term and welcomes students of all faiths and backgrounds. Morningside offers five bachelor's degrees, including bachelor of arts, bachelor of science, bachelor of music, bachelor of music education, and bachelor of nursing, and a master of arts in teaching degree. The college was founded in 1894 by the Methodist Episcopal Church and remains affiliated with the United Methodist Church today.
